Hi Maurice,

> I notice that my bluequartz doesn't allow directory listing in apache, and 
> 5107R does allow it.

It can be configured through the GUI:

"Network Settings" / "Web". Then "Options" and untick the box for "Indexes".

> I think it is better to not allow it, it gives a slightly bit more safety.

Correct. On the other hand: By default we don't create websites with no index 
page in it. So if someone creates an empty directory and puts no index page 
into it, do we cover up his mistake by simply denying directory listing, or 
are we fighting what the user intends to do? This is a somewhat tricky 
territory.
